[Anorectal diagnostics for proctological diseases].

T Jackisch1, H Witzigmann, S Stelzner

  • 1Klinik für Allgemein- und Viszeralchirurgie, Krankenhaus Dresden-Friedrichstadt, Friedrichstr. 41, 01067, Dresden, Deutschland. jackisch-th@khdf.de

Der Chirurg; Zeitschrift Fur Alle Gebiete Der Operativen Medizen
|November 15, 2012
PubMed
Summary
This summary is machine-generated.

Accurate proctological diagnosis relies on symptom evaluation and imaging like MRI. Combining objective imaging with validated scoring systems improves treatment outcomes for anorectal disorders.

Area of Science:

  • Proctology and diagnostic imaging techniques.
  • Pelvic floor disorders and functional assessments.

Context:

  • Standard proctological diagnosis involves symptom evaluation and physical exams.
  • Advanced imaging like MRI and endosonography aid in complex anal fistula detection.
  • MR defecography is crucial for diagnosing multifactorial functional anorectal disorders.

Purpose:

  • To highlight the importance of objective visualization in proctological diagnostics.
  • To emphasize the role of MR defecography in evaluating pelvic floor irregularities.
  • To underscore the need for validated scoring systems in clinical practice.

Summary:

  • Magnetic resonance imaging (MRI) offers superior objective visualization for complex anal fistulas compared to endosonography.
  • Functional anorectal disorders require comprehensive assessment due to multifactorial causes and pelvic floor irregularities, making MR defecography a key diagnostic tool.
  • Interpreting results from anal endosonography, manometry, and neurophysiological tests is challenging due to variability; validated scores are essential for objective measurement of symptom severity and quality of life.

Impact:

  • Optimizing proctological diagnostics and therapy evaluation by integrating morphological findings with subjective perception scores.
  • Enhancing patient care through more accurate diagnosis and tailored treatment strategies.
  • Establishing the necessity of well-validated scores for objective assessment in clinical proctology research and practice.
